This is very true for selling houses as well. Many potential buyers make up their minds within seconds of walking through the door.<br \/>\n\tSo it makes sense to get this part of the house looking great. The entrance area should generate some excitement, drama and style. Create a focal point with an oversized mirror, a dramatic piece of art, lighting a key feature, fresh flowers, a chair or small pieces of furniture \u2013 but not all at once. Add drama, not comedy.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>You will have heard the saying, \u2018you don\u2019t get a second chance to make a first impression\u2019.
